Compliance is the cornerstone of any successful screening program. Background checks must navigate a complex web of federal regulations, such as the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A), alongside varying state-specific laws. These state laws often dictate how far back a search can go, how criminal records are reported, and the required disclosures to candidates. Industry-Specific Screening Requirements
Different industries face unique regulatory pressures that dictate the type of background checks required. For example, the transportation sector is heavily regulated by federal agencies that mandate specific screenings for safety-sensitive positions. FMCSA (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ration) and PHMSA (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ration) background checks are critical for companies operating commercial vehicles or hazardous materials.
These specialized checks go beyond standard criminal and employment verification. They often include drug testing, driving record checks, and verification of commercial driver's licenses. Other industries, such as healthcare and finance, also have stringent requirements. Healthcare facilities must verify professional licenses and check national offender databases to protect vulnerable patients. Financial institutions must adhere to strict anti-money laundering (AML) regulations, which often require enhanced due diligence on employees. Comprehensive Drug Testing Programs
Workplace safety is inextricably linked to drug and alcohol testing programs. Employers need a reliable partner to manage the logistics of specimen collection, laboratory analysis, and result reporting. The process involves several critical steps. First, the employer must determine which employees are subject to testing, such as pre-employment, random, post-accident, or reasonable suspicion testing. Next, the physical collection of specimens must be conducted by certified collectors to ensure chain of custody integrity. Finally, the results must be reviewed by a Medical Review Officer (MRO) to rule out legitimate medical explanations for positive results.
